    Abstract: A head up display (HUD) with improved resistance to sunload for use in a vehicle comprising an image generating device, an LCD assembly, an optical bonding assembly, and a fold mirror, with specific design countermeasures to combat damage caused to an LCD by heat from sunlight. These include an OB glass and cold mirror film (CMF) as components of the optical bonding assembly, a hot mirror coating and a polarized film as components of the LCD assembly, and a cold mirror coating on the fold mirror. When sunlight enters the HUD, the cold mirror coating reflects only visible light towards the LCD. The hot mirror coating reflects infrared and ultraviolet wavelengths of light away from the LCD. The polarized film cuts p-polarized light. The OB glass and CMF increase the specific heat of the HUD. The HUD thereby reduces sunload that would otherwise damage the LCD due to heat stress.

    Abstract: An Artificial Intelligence (AI)-based data transformation system receives an input package and enables automatic execution of one or more processes in a robotic process automation system (RPA). The input package includes a plurality of documents and metadata required for the execution of the automated processes. The plurality of documents are categorized into a domain. Entities with their corresponding name-value pairs and entity relationships are extracted from the plurality of documents. An ontology is selected based on the domain. The entities are mapped to output fields identified from the selected ontology. The mappings thus generated are transmitted to the RPA system which employs the mappings to automatically execute the one or more processes.

    Abstract: A first user of a first account associated with a service platform is authenticated based on one or more credentials. Whether the first account of the authenticated first user is authorized to operate in an impersonation mode that enables the first account to impersonate a second account's access to the service platform is determined. Subsequent to authorizing the first account to operate in the impersonation mode a subset of function calls to be called by the first account when impersonating the second account is identified among a plurality of function calls that are permitted to be called by the second account. Information identifying the subset of function calls to be called by the first account when impersonating the second account is providing to a client device associated with the first account.

    Abstract: The disclosure reveals a system for optimizing control devices in a clean room environment with intelligent flow curve tools. The system may incorporate a controller and one or more valves for airflow control in a space, connected to the controller. The controller may incorporate a user interface that has a display and a control mechanism. The controller may contain one or more airflow tables corresponding to the one or more valves, respectively. Also, the controller may have a curve tool that can provide an airflow table on the display in one or more formats.

    Abstract: Disclosed herein are representative embodiments of technologies that can be used to generate medical-claims simulations that can provide information about medical claims. In one exemplary embodiment disclosed herein, medical claims data is received, and a dynamic questionnaire is output. Selections of questionnaire options are received, and based on the medical claims data and the selection of the questionnaire options, at least one medical-claims simulation is generated. The dynamic questionnaire can be driven by user interaction and can enable users of the system to select, validate, and filter data, which can then be submitted for payment and mapping analysis.
